About 1-[(1R)-1-(5-amino-2-pyridinyl)-1-[3-fluoro-5-(trifluoromethyl)phenyl]-2-(3-methylphenyl)ethyl]-3-cyclopentylurea

1-[(1R)-1-(5-amino-2-pyridinyl)-1-[3-fluoro-5-(trifluoromethyl)phenyl]-2-(3-methylphenyl)ethyl]-3-cyclopentylurea (PubChem CID 71195704) has the molecular formula C27H28F4N4O and a molecular weight of 500.54 g/mol. Its IUPAC name is 1-[(1R)-1-(5-amino-2-pyridinyl)-1-[3-fluoro-5-(trifluoromethyl)phenyl]-2-(3-methylphenyl)ethyl]-3-cyclopentylurea.
